Painted Rug

I needed a rug for my laundry room and the doorway to the garage.

It had to be FUN so I set out to jazz up a plain ole’ sisal rug.

I found a 4 x 6 sisal rug at TJ Maxx for only $10.00! I cut out a couple chevron stripes with my Silhouette.
(My husband thinks you should know that you don’t really need a Silhouette to make a chevron stripe.)

I needed it to be pretty big. So I cut it out a couple times and then taped it together.

Then I taped around each stripe and pushed down on the blue tape so no paint would bleed through.

I used some semi-gloss paint (this beautiful blue came from my friend‘s kitchen) and a couple of foam brushes.

And then I went to work “dabbing” the blue paint in my taped off section. This took me a while. But it was a good workout for my arms!

Adding lots of paint to seep in between all the grooves.

The paint seemed to dry pretty quickly.

As I peeled off the tape my chevron stripes were revealed.
